Camel house, Berlin Zoological Garden, Germany (colour litho)

7172154 Camel house, Berlin Zoological Garden, Germany (colour litho) by German School, (20th century); Private Collection; (add.info.: Camel house, Berlin Zoological Garden, Germany, built by Kayser & Groszheim in 1897, and group of centaurs by German sculptor Reinhold Begas. Illustration from Ansichten aus dem Zoologischen Garten zu Berlin (Verlag des Aktien-Vereins des Zoologischen Gartens zu Berlin, Berlin, c1901). Credit: Paul Neumann.); © Look and Learn

E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ases the iconic Camel House in Berlin Zoological Garden, Germany. The vibrant color lithograph captures the essence of this architectural marvel, which was built by Kayser & Groszheim in 1897. Standing proudly amidst a picturesque landscape, the Camel House is adorned with a group of centaurs sculpted by renowned German artist Reinhold Begas. The image is sourced from "Ansichten aus dem Zoologischen Garten zu Berlin" a publication that beautifully illustrates various aspects of the zoo. This particular illustration, dating back to around 1901, offers us a glimpse into early twentieth-century Germany and its rich cultural heritage.
